TORONTO (Reuters) - WestJet Airlines Ltd (WJA.TO: Quote) posted a 46 percent decrease in third-quarter earnings on Wednesday as the Canadian airline struggled with weak consumer confidence and heightened competition in the industry.
Canada's No. 2 airline reported earnings of C$31.4 million ($29.6 million), or 24 Canadian cents a share, for the three months to end-September, down from a profit of C$57.9 million, or 45 Canadian cents, in the same period a year earlier.
WestJet's revenue fell 16.4 percent to C$600.6 million.
